官方PyPI资源下载:aws_cdk.aws_events_targets-1.8.0
版权申诉
ZIP格式 | 90KB |
更新于2024-10-18
| 31 浏览量 | 举报
资源摘要信息:"PyPI官网下载的资源文件名为'aws_cdk.aws_events_targets-1.8.0-py3-none-any.whl',它是一个Python库,可用于云计算环境。此文件为AWS CDK(Cloud Development Kit)的一部分,专门针对AWS的服务'aws_events_targets'。AWS CDK是AWS提供的一套开发工具,用于定义云资源。该版本为1.8.0,兼容Python 3,无特定平台限制,任何平台均可安装。"
在详细介绍这些知识点之前,我们首先需要明确几个关键概念。PyPI代表Python Package Index,是Python的包管理系统,类似于Java中的Maven Central或Node.js中的NPM,用于发布和获取Python包。AWS代表Amazon Web Services,是全球领先的云服务提供商,提供一系列广泛的云服务。CDK则是AWS推出的云开发工具,它允许开发者使用熟悉的编程语言编写基础设施代码,并将其转化为云资源。
1. AWS CDK (Cloud Development Kit)
AWS CDK是AWS推出的一套开源软件开发框架,用于定义云基础设施代码并将其部署到AWS。它允许开发者使用熟悉的编程语言如JavaScript、TypeScript、Python、Java和.NET来编写应用程序。CDK的核心思想是将基础设施作为代码,这意味着可以使用版本控制、自动化测试和持续集成等DevOps实践。
2. aws_events_targets
aws_events_targets是AWS CDK中的一个模块,它为AWS Events服务提供了目标支持。AWS Events服务允许用户根据时间表、事件或触发器安排工作流。aws_events_targets模块为事件目标的定义提供了一种编程方式,比如一个事件可以触发EC2实例的启动,或者触发Lambda函数的执行。
3. Python库与PyPI
Python库是一系列预先编写好的Python代码,可以方便地在其他Python程序中使用。它们可以执行各种任务,从数据分析到网络编程等。PyPI是Python包的官方索引和分发服务。开发者可以在这个平台上发布自己的Python库供他人使用。用户可以通过pip工具,这是Python的包管理工具,来安装PyPI上的库。
4. PyPI官方下载
当用户通过PyPI官方网站下载某个Python库时,通常下载的是一个或多个包含库代码、文档和其他资源的压缩包文件,其文件扩展名可能为.tar.gz或.whl。.whl文件代表wheel格式,它是一种Python的二进制包格式,旨在加快安装速度并解决依赖关系问题。
5. .whl文件的结构和内容
一个.wheel文件通常包含以下内容:
- 一个或多个Python模块或包文件;
- 一个METADATA文件,它描述了包的元数据,如名称、版本、作者和依赖关系;
- 一个RECORD文件,它记录了wheel文件中所有文件的校验和;
- 有时还包含一个WHEEL文件,用于描述生成这个wheel文件的工具和平台信息;
- 其他可能的资源文件,比如文档、示例代码等。
6. 在Python环境中使用.wheel文件
在Python环境中安装.wheel文件通常非常简单。用户可以使用pip命令行工具安装它,例如:
```
pip install aws_cdk.aws_events_targets-1.8.0-py3-none-any.whl
```
该命令会将aws_events_targets库安装在用户的Python环境中,使其可以被任何兼容的Python项目调用。
综上所述,文件名为'aws_cdk.aws_events_targets-1.8.0-py3-none-any.whl'的资源文件是PyPI官网提供的,用于在Python环境中使用AWS CDK来开发和管理AWS Events目标。通过这个库,开发者可以更加高效和方便地实现AWS服务之间的集成和自动化。
相关推荐